S'wak surpasses tourism target with 3.18 million arrivals as of October


State Tourism, Creative Industry and Performing Arts Minister Datuk Seri Abdul Karim Rahman Hamzah (centre) chatting with his deputy minister Datuk Sebastian Ting (left) and Speaker Tan Sri Mohamad Asfia Awang Nassar at the Sarawak Legislative Assembly. - ZULAZHAR SHEBLEE/The Star

KUCHING: Sarawak has received 3.18 million visitors as of October, exceeding its target of three million arrivals this year.

This is an increase of 131% from the same period last year, according to state Tourism, Creative Industry and Performing Arts Minister Datuk Seri Abdul Karim Rahman Hamzah.
